Transaction ef07ccaffb71d1078d7598c1303d9d0f18a484f26496f2bf9450bcbcfa7ca2bc
1 Input
1 Output
-
ef07ccaffb71d1078d7598c1303d9d0f18a484f26496f2bf9450bcbcfa7ca2bc:0
- value
- 284507
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8bd4a52a73199ca4bcd367b038136373e3526019 OP_EQUAL
- address
- 3ESNb46iAGyr5c6Tb3VHMGxmMZq43YWiS3